The Graphic Design MA program at the Estonian Academy of Arts (EKA) is intended to develop a student's practice and define their position as a graphic designer.

The programme takes an expanded view of graphic design, seeing it as a form of knowledge production whose role can be understood as a way of "making things public".

The programme provides opportunities for students to work through traditional models of graphic design, including books, websites, posters, typefaces and videos, and also to publish texts, organise exhibitions, host lectures, teach workshops, and create other contexts for exchange during their studies.

The interests and concerns of the student will be placed at the centre of studies through the making of a body of work which considers their relationship to form, content, production, and the distribution of information.

While this will identify itself differently for each student, what they will share in common is a form of practice which is self-reflective, process-oriented, collaborative, and one that consistently holds an honest position in response to the fluctuating conditions of work as a graphic designer.
